Возможно ли это , чтобы назначить NaNк doubleили floatв C / C ++? Как и в JavaScript вы: a = NaN. Так что позже вы можете проверить, является ли переменная числом или
Возможно ли это , чтобы назначить NaNк doubleили floatв C / C ++? Как и в JavaScript вы: a = NaN. Так что позже вы можете проверить, является ли переменная числом или
У меня есть программа, которая пытается уменьшить doubleдо желаемого числа. На выходе я получаю NaN. Что NaNзначит на
Я читал о числах с плавающей запятой и понимаю, что NaN может быть результатом операций. Но я не могу понять, что именно это за концепции. В чем разница между ними? Какой из них можно создать при программировании на C ++? Могу ли я как программист написать программу, вызывающую сигнал SNAN?...
В большинстве языков есть константа NaN, которую можно использовать для присвоения переменной значения NaN. Может ли Python сделать это без использования numpy?
У меня есть таблица x: website 0 http://www.google.com/ 1 http://www.yahoo.com 2 None Я хочу заменить python None на pandas NaN. Я старался: x.replace(to_replace=None, value=np.nan) Но я получил: TypeError: 'regex' must be a string or a compiled regular expression or a list or dict of strings or...
Я хотел бы заменить неверные значения в столбце фрейма данных на NaN. mydata = {'x' : [10, 50, 18, 32, 47, 20], 'y' : ['12', '11', 'N/A', '13', '15', 'N/A']} df = pd.DataFrame(mydata) df[df.y == 'N/A']['y'] = np.nan Однако последняя строка не работает и выдает предупреждение, потому что она...
Я работаю с этим фреймом данных Pandas на Python. File heat Farheit Temp_Rating 1 YesQ 75 N/A 1 NoR 115 N/A 1 YesA 63 N/A 1 NoT 83 41 1 NoY 100 80 1 YesZ 56 12 2 YesQ 111 N/A 2 NoR 60 N/A 2 YesA 19 N/A 2 NoT 106 77 2 NoY 45 21 2 YesZ 40 54 3 YesQ 84 N/A 3 NoR 67 N/A 3 YesA 94 N/A 3 NoT 68 39 3 NoY...
Я читаю два столбца файла csv, используя pandas, readcsv()а затем присваиваю значения словарю. Столбцы содержат строки цифр и букв. Иногда бывают случаи, когда ячейка пуста. На мой взгляд, значение, считываемое этой словарной статье, должно быть, Noneно вместо этого nanприсваивается. Конечно,...
>>> (float('inf')+0j)*1 (inf+nanj) Зачем? Это вызвало неприятную ошибку в моем коде. Почему 1мультипликативная идентичность не дает (inf + 0j)?
У меня есть двумерный массив numpy. Некоторые из значений в этом массиве NaN. Я хочу выполнить определенные операции с этим массивом. Например, рассмотрим массив: [[ 0. 43. 67. 0. 38.] [ 100. 86. 96. 100. 94.] [ 76. 79. 83. 89. 56.] [ 88. NaN 67. 89. 81.] [ 94. 79. 67. 89. 69.] [ 88. 79. 58. 72....
В чем разница между groupby("x").countи groupby("x").sizeв пандах? Размер исключает только ноль?
Мне нужно вычислить количество элементов, отличных от NaN, в матрице numpy ndarray. Как можно эффективно сделать это в Python? Вот мой простой код для этого: import numpy as np def numberOfNonNans(data): count = 0 for i in data: if not np.isnan(i): count += 1 return count Есть ли для этого...
Я пытаюсь использовать imshow в matplotlib для построения данных в виде тепловой карты, но некоторые из значений являются NaN. Я бы хотел, чтобы NaN отображались как особый цвет, которого нет в цветовой карте. пример: import numpy as np import matplotlib.pyplot as plt f = plt.figure() ax =...
Есть ли способ заменить значения Noneв Pandas в Python? Вы можете использовать df.replace('pre', 'post')и можете заменить одно значение другим, но этого нельзя сделать, если вы хотите заменить на Noneзначение, которое при попытке получить странный результат. Итак, вот пример: df =...
Для функции, которую я пишу, я бы хотел вернуть Nan, если ввод не имеет смысла. Как мне проще всего вставить NaN в регистр xmm